numam-dpdk/lib
Ian Stokes 812f48370f cryptodev: fix build with -Ofast
When compiling with an application that includes rte_cryptodev.h with
Ofast, an error is reported regarding enumeration
RTE_CRYPTO_OP_TYPE_UNDEFINED not handled in switch case in function
 __rte_crypto_op_reset().

Fix this by adding a case for RTE_CRYPTO_OP_TYPE_UNDEFINED.

Fixes: c0f87eb525 ("cryptodev: change burst API to be crypto op oriented")
Cc: stable@dpdk.org

Signed-off-by: Ian Stokes <ian.stokes@intel.com>
Acked-by: Pablo de Lara <pablo.de.lara.guarch@intel.com>
2017-10-25 18:10:40 +02:00
..
librte_acl m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_bitratestats m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_cfgfile cfgfile: rework load function 2017-10-09 00:50:48 +02:00
librte_cmdline m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_compat fix typos using codespell utility 2017-06-14 23:54:13 +02:00
librte_cryptodev cryptodev: fix build with -Ofast 2017-10-25 18:10:40 +02:00
librte_distributor m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_eal service: allow to disable core check 2017-10-25 17:05:38 +02:00
librte_efd m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_ether m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_eventdev eventdev: add service id get to map file 2017-10-25 14:03:43 +02:00
librte_flow_classify flow_classify: introduce flow classify library 2017-10-24 22:26:54 +02:00
librte_gro m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_gso m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_hash m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_ip_frag m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_jobstats m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_kni m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_kvargs m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_latencystats m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_lpm lpm6: set errno on creation error 2017-10-24 21:35:53 +02:00
librte_mbuf m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_member m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_mempool m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_meter m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_metrics m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_net m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_pdump m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_pipeline m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_port m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_power m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_reorder m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_ring m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_sched m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_table table: update library version 2017-10-24 13:38:31 +02:00
librte_timer mk: do not generate LDLIBS from directory dependencies 2017-10-24 02:14:57 +02:00
librte_vhost vhost: fix dequeue offload support 2017-10-24 21:31:23 +02:00
Makefile flow_classify: introduce flow classify library 2017-10-24 22:26:54 +02:00